Q. Jorwe culture, a Chalcolithic culture, was first discovered in which of the following states of India?
Answer: Maharashtra
Notes: Jorwe is a village and an archaeological site located on the banks of the Godavari River in Ahmednagar district of Maharashtra. This site was first was excavated in 1950-51 under the direction of Hasmukh Dhirajlal Sankalia and Shantaram Bhalchandra Deo.
